Transaction 57720874add30e4ede8c841da72e40aaf88605e6c80f3b9ffab2eb899049274c
1 Input
1 Output
-
57720874add30e4ede8c841da72e40aaf88605e6c80f3b9ffab2eb899049274c:0
- value
- 282824
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ba0868045ce41a7dca74ebcf20804f4818184700 OP_EQUAL
- address
- 3JefgJfNboxm8jY3rXEsC45z8Sn8pnEGFy